Pop-Top Addition

Expanding a Growing Family’s Home

As their family grew, these homeowners found themselves running out of space. Rather than move, they chose to expand the home they already loved by adding a second-story “pop-top” addition.

The project added a new primary suite and an additional bedroom, creating comfortable space for their growing kids while maintaining the character of the original home. Part of the design also reconfigured the existing upper floor, converting a small bedroom into an open loft space that now functions as a flexible hangout area.

Along with the interior expansion, the exterior of the home was completely refreshed with new siding and updated materials, giving the house a cohesive and modern appearance.

Throughout the design process, we explored several exterior material and color options with the homeowners using renderings, helping them visualize how different choices would shape the final look of the home.

This project is a great example of how a thoughtful pop-top addition can transform a modest house into a long-term family home without leaving the neighborhood they love.
